			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p class="MsoNormal"><img src="http://a.abcnews.com/images/GMA/abc_gmanow_tea_080109_mn.jpg" alt="Mark Ukra" width="320" height="240" /></p>
<p class="MsoNormal">Mark Ukra, also known as <a href="http://teagarden.com/" target="_blank">Dr. Tea</a>, enlightened viewers about different aspects of tea in promotion of his book, <a href="http://www.amazon.com/Ultimate-Tea-Diet-Metabolism-Kick-Start/dp/0061441759/ref=pd_bbs_sr_1?ie=UTF8&amp;s=books&amp;qid=1213372109&amp;sr=1-1" target="_blank"><em>The Ultimate Tea Diet</em></a>.</p>
<p class="MsoNormal">Ukra implores consumers to opt for tea over coffee, as coffee raises insulin levels, traps body fat, and dehydrates, while tea promotes weight loss and provides antioxidants that are critical for overall health.</p>
<p class="MsoNormal">Despite the rainbow of names, white tea, green tea, oolong tea, black tea, and red tea are all from the same plant, and all provide the same weight-loss benefits; the differences lie in various levels of processing and caffeine content.</p>
<p>Dr. Tea recommends pyramid bags, which allow the plant to bloom, rather than shredded tea in paper bags; he also produces a line of &#8220;craving teas,&#8221; which are flavored and can satisfy desires for less healthy snack foods.</p>]]></content:encoded>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p class="MsoNormal"><img src="http://farm1.static.flickr.com/141/403723103_10ef1155d3.jpg?v=0" alt="Joan &amp; Christina Crawford" width="309" height="407" /></p>
<p class="MsoNormal"><a href="http://www.amazon.com/Dearest-Thirtieth-Anniversary-Christina-Crawford/dp/0966336933/ref=sr_1_6?ie=UTF8&amp;s=books&amp;qid=1213370752&amp;sr=8-6" target="_blank"><em>Mommie Dearest</em></a>, the classic tell-all book about the child abuse allegedly perpetrated by actress <a href="http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Joan_Crawford" target="_blank">Joan Crawford</a>, has been reissued by her daughter, <a href="http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Christina_Crawford" target="_blank">Christina Crawford</a>.</p>
<p class="MsoNormal">Christina, one of four adopted children, recounts several incidents of trauma in the book; she and her brother, Chris, were not named in Joan Crawford&#8217;s will, which many suspect is due to the book&#8217;s publication. Joan Crawford&#8217;s other daughters, Cindy and Cathy, insist that none of the events are true, and have distanced themselves from their older sister because of the accusations.</p>
<p class="MsoNormal">The book has been reissued for the 30th anniversary of the original 1978 publication.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p class="MsoNormal"><img src="http://www.martinfrost.ws/htmlfiles/salman_rushdie.jpg" alt="Salman Rushdie" width="288" height="456" /></p>
<p class="MsoNormal">Noted author <a href="http://www.mahalo.com/Salman_Rushdie" target="_blank">Salman Rushdie</a> visited <a href="http://abc.go.com/daytime/theview/index" target="_blank"><em>The View</em></a> to speak about his latest work, <a href="http://www.amazon.com/Enchantress-Florence-Novel-Salman-Rushdie/dp/0375504338/ref=pd_bbs_sr_1?ie=UTF8&amp;s=books&amp;qid=1212420820&amp;sr=8-1" target="_blank"><em>The Enchantress of Florence</em></a>. Like his other novels, Rushdie&#8217;s <em>Enchantress</em> takes readers on a historical journey, using real-life events that are bolstered by contemporary characters.</p>
<p class="MsoNormal">After writing<em> <a href="http://www.amazon.com/Satanic-Verses-Novel-Salman-Rushdie/dp/0812976711/ref=pd_bbs_sr_1?ie=UTF8&amp;s=books&amp;qid=1212420839&amp;sr=1-1" target="_blank">The Satanic Verses</a></em>, Rushdie was forced into hiding because of a fatwa issued by the Iranian state in the late 1980s. He got married while in hiding, and has been married a total of 4 times, with two sons.</p>
<p class="MsoNormal">Rushdie&#8217;s other projects include playing a gynecologist in <a href="http://www.imdb.com/title/tt0455805/" target="_blank"><em>Then She Found Me</em></a>, a recent film starring Helen Hunt.</p>]]></content:encoded>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><img src="http://www.defectiveyeti.com/images/scott-point.jpg" alt="Scott McClellan" width="365" height="260" /></p>
<p>Tell-all publications are no longer Hollywood&#8217;s domain; the revelation genre has spread to Washington as well.</p>
<p>Former White House Press Secretary <a href="http://www.mahalo.com/Scott_McClellan" target="_blank">Scott McClellan</a> has written his insider&#8217;s view of events in his book, <a href="http://www.amazon.com/What-Happened-Washingtons-Culture-Deception/dp/1586485563/ref=pd_bbs_sr_1?ie=UTF8&amp;s=books&amp;qid=1211988462&amp;sr=8-1" target="_blank"><em>What Happened: Inside The Bush White House And Washington&#8217;s Culture Of Deception</em></a>. In it, <a href="http://www.abcnews.go.com/GMA/Politics/story?id=4945364&amp;page=1" target="_blank">McClellan</a> writes about Bush&#8217;s policies of evasion and masking the truth regarding the war in Iraq, half-hearted recovery efforts along the Gulf Coast after Hurricane Katrina, and other cases of incompetence within the administration.</p>
<p>The ladies of <a href="http://abc.go.com/daytime/theview/index" target="_blank"><em>The View</em></a> discussed McClellan&#8217;s possible reasons for waiting until now, when the country is embroiled in war and economic downturn, to reveal what he claims he knew. Whoopi and Joy remarked that McClellan&#8217;s comments would have been much more beneficial to the country had he spoken up earlier, while Elisabeth points out the fact that the book deal is likely much more lucrative now than it would have been earlier in the term.</p>]]></content:encoded>
